
How a Major Freight Railroad Scaled Pipeline Creation with Genie Code
AI Executive Summary
One of Canada's largest railway networks, spanning 20,000 route miles, utilized Databricks Genie Code, Unity Catalog, and custom Agent Skills to automate pipeline creation, achieving over 90% automation for new table ingestion and compressing pipeline delivery from days to minutes.
The company's modernization program now scales with the business, leveraging a repeatable factory approach to pipeline development.
This approach enabled the team to generate production-ready ingestion code grounded in live catalog metadata and aligned to enterprise conventions by default.

Agentic AI
Agentic AI refers to artificial intelligence systems designed to act autonomously, make decisions, plan workflows, and execute tasks without constant human intervention. Unlike traditional models that only respond to queries, agentic systems use an agentic loop to perceive environments, reason over goals, use tools, and iterate to achieve outcomes.
Series A
Series A funding is the first major round of institutional equity financing, aimed at startups that have demonstrated product-market fit and are ready to scale.
